Lambertus Jacobus Johannes Aafjes, known as Bertus Aafjes, was a Dutch auhor and poet whose work is marked by Catholicism.
Aafjes was born in Amsterdam. He wrote poems on the resistance to the German occupation during the World War II. He died in Venlo.
Between 1951 and 1973 he lived and worked on a real castle, the Castle Hoensbroek, near Maastricht in The Netherlands (see photo).
